+# A helper subroutine for detecting (based on MAKEFLAGS) if make jobserver
+# is enabled, if it is available or MAKEFLAGS contains "jobs" option.
+# It returns current status (jobserver, jobserver-unavailable or jobs-N where
+# N is number of jobs, 0 if infinite) and MAKEFLAGS cleaned up from
+# job control options.
+sub get_make_jobserver_status {
+ my $jobsre = qr/(?:^|\s)(?:(?:-j\s*|--jobs(?:=|\s+))(\d+)?|--jobs)\b/;
+ my $status = "";
+ my $makeflags;
+
+ if (exists $ENV{MAKEFLAGS}) {
+ $makeflags = $ENV{MAKEFLAGS};
+ if ($makeflags =~ /(?:^|\s)--jobserver-fds=(\d+)/) {
+ $status = "jobserver";
+ if (!open(my $in, "<&", "$1")) {
+ # Job server is unavailable
+ $status .= "-unavailable";
+ }
+ else {
+ close $in;
+ }
+ # Clean makeflags up
+ $makeflags =~ s/(?:^|\s)--jobserver-fds=\S+//g;
+ $makeflags =~ s/(?:^|\s)-j\b//g;
+ }
+ elsif (my @m = ($makeflags =~ /$jobsre/g)) {
+ # Job count is specified in MAKEFLAGS. Whenever make reads it, a new
+ # jobserver will be started. Job count returned is 0 if infinite.
+ $status = "jobs-" . (defined $m[$#m] ? $m[$#m] : "0");
+ # Clean makeflags up from "jobs" option(s)
+ $makeflags =~ s/$jobsre//g;
+ }
+ }
+ if ($status) {
+ # MAKEFLAGS could be unset if it is empty
+ $makeflags = undef if $makeflags =~ /^\s*$/;
+ }
+ return wantarray ? ($status, $makeflags) : $status;
+}
